Fairview Township, York County, Pennsylvania Total Number and Rate of Violent and Property Crimes in 2011

Updated on January 14, 2025.

According to the FBI UCR data, in 2011, the total number of violent crimes for the city of Fairview Township, York County, PA, was 27, and the violent crime rate per 100K residents was 161.47. The total number of property crimes was 282 and the property crime rate per 100K residents was 1,686.5.
